Today, Overactive Media — the proprietorship behind the Toronto Defiant of the Overwatch League, and the Call of Duty League's Toronto Ultra — reported designs for another 7,000-seat complex in the city, which is intended to have both serious gaming matches and also different occasions like shows and concerts, specifically, opera! The arena is believed to cost around $500 million to construct. It is supposed to open in 2025. The new eSports complex will be situated at Exhibition Place in Toronto, which is additionally home to BMO Field, where Football (American) club Toronto FC plays. Its development is being handed over to Populous, the engineering firm behind late ventures like Tottenham Hotspur Stadium in London and T-Mobile Arena in Las Vegas. "The plan of the venue was neither imagined as a games field nor an opera house, rather, another typology that rides the two: a best in class execution scene," Populous lead creator Jonathan Mallie said in an interview. "The theater engineering makes a consolidation of the old and the new." [Source] Overactive says it intends to have about 200 events every year, and, beside esports and concerts, that is relied upon to incorporate "significant city-wide shows, corporate occasions and item dispatches, and entertainment expos." Meanwhile, the organization likewise says that it is "as of now in dynamic conversations to attract the biggest esport tournaments on the planet." [source] 4 Quote Link to post Share on other sites
